What to do while you wait for your Berkeley appointment

  • Rinse, do not scrub: warm salt water every few hours calms the gum and clears debris around a cracked or infected tooth.
  • Cold, not heat: a wrapped ice pack on the cheek limits swelling. Heat spreads it.
  • Keep the pieces: a chipped fragment or a crown that came off can sometimes be reattached, so bring it with you.
  • Eat carefully: soft foods, nothing very hot or cold, and chew away from the sore side until you are seen.

How much does an emergency dentist cost in Berkeley, CA?

Most emergency visits in Berkeley have two parts: the exam with an X-ray, then the treatment itself. You always hear the treatment price before anything is done. The figures below are based on partner clinic fee schedules in mid-sized cities and are meant as a guide, not a quote.

Emergency dental costs in Berkeley
TreatmentBerkeley range (no insurance)With insurance (typical)
Emergency exam + X-ray$100–$230$0–$50 copay
Simple extraction$150–$40020–50% of fee
Abscess drainage$200–$50020–50% of fee
Root canal$750–$1,50030–50% of fee
Temporary crown$100–$30050% of fee
